CHURCH SERVICES.
CHURCH OF ENGLAND.— 15th Sunday after Trinity.—B a.m., Holy Communion ; II a.m., Matins and Sermon; 2.30 p.m., Sunday School; 7 p.m., Evensong and Sermon; 2.30 p.m., Oroua Downs, —Rev G. Y. Woodward, L.Th. PRESBYTERIAN CHURCH.— Foxton, li a.m., Rev ). M. Thomson, M.A. ; 2.30 p.m., Sabbath School; 7 p.m., Mr G. Huntley.
SALVATION ARMY.—Sunday, 7 a.m., knee drill; II a.m., Holiness Meeting; 3 p.m., Free and Easy (enrolment of recruits); 7 p.m., Salvation.
Thursday, Sept. 19th.—Social address by Mrs Lieut.-Coloncl Fisher, assisted by Mrs Staft-Capt. Newbold. All heartily invited Capt. Pike. CATHOLIC SERVICES—Mass, 8.30- a.ra.; Devotions, 7 p.m, —Rev Father Kelly. PRIMITIVE METHODIST C H U R C H.—Foxton (Coronation Town Hall Supper-room), II a,m., and 7 p.m., Rev N. Hyde (Shannon) ; Shannon, II am., and 7 p.m., Rev T, Coatsworth; Open-air service in Main Street at 8,30 p.m.
